7-Eleven Storefront Crash Settlement Highlights Importance of Retail Security and Perimeter Security

On Feb. 6, a Chicago-area man received a record-breaking $91 million settlement from 7-Eleven after losing both his legs in an accidental crash outside one of the company’s stores in Bensenville, Illinois, in 2017.

Suspect Arrested in Home Depot Homicide Investigation

Police in Hillsborough, North Carolina have arrested a man in connection with the October 2022 robbery incident that led to the homicide of Home Depot employee Gary Rasor.
